Tamie Wainwright
// TLDR
Tamie M. Wainwright, a lifelong Harford County resident and community advocate, is a Democratic candidate for County Council in District F. Her platform emphasizes smart governance, shared solutions, and sustainable growth, focusing on responsible development, fiscal responsibility, and environmental protection. Notably, she has led initiatives like the 3P Protect Perryman Peninsula coalition, advocating for balanced growth and infrastructure improvements in her community.

// POLICY POSITIONS
Growth Management: Advocates for sustainable, responsible, and community-guided growth supported by modern infrastructure and policies. Emphasizes the need to modernize zoning and land use policies to reflect current realities.
Fiscal Responsibility: Supports fiscal discipline and responsible budgeting, ensuring that growth pays for itself without burdening existing residents.
Community Advocacy: Committed to transparent communication, thoughtful planning, and decisions grounded in both research and lived experience. Prioritizes protecting land, honoring history, and building a future where every family can thrive.
Zoning and Land Use Policy: Plans to request a full code and policy audit to identify outdated language and inconsistencies, followed by a zoning modernization initiative to update definitions and align zoning with the county’s comprehensive plan.
Environmental Protection: Emphasizes the importance of environmental protection, particularly in the Perryman/Aberdeen area, advocating for responsible development and better infrastructure to protect the Chesapeake Bay watershed and drinking water.
